The Justice Department is investigating the mishandling of remains at
Arlington National Cemetery in a broad criminal inquiry that is also
seeking evidence of possible contracting fraud and falsification of
records, people familiar with the investigation said Tuesday.
A federal grand jury in Alexandria has been subpoenaing witnesses and
records relating to the scandal at the nation’s most venerated
military burial ground, sources said. The investigation, conducted by
the FBI and the Army’s Criminal Investigation Command, has been
underway for at least six months, according to sources who spoke on
the condition of anonymity because they were not authorized to speak
publicly.
